The keyword refers to a highly specific Cisco IOS-on-Unix (IOU) binary image file used by network engineers for advanced laboratory simulation. Formatted cleanly as i86bi_linux-l3-adventerprisek9-m.157-3.M2.bin , this specific file represents a Layer 3 Advanced Enterprise Cisco IOS software image compiled for x86 Linux environments , released natively around May 2018 . It functions as a lightweight, resource-efficient staple within network emulation environments like GNS3 and EVE-NG to mimic corporate Enterprise routing infrastructure. This image runs Cisco IOS version 15.7(3)M2, which is the standard IOS (not IOS-XE). It includes enterprise-class Layer 3 features and security protocols like BGP, OSPF, and EIGRP, IPsec VPNs for secure tunnels, MPLS for advanced service provider networks, and management protocols like SSH, SNMP, and AAA.
